About This Course

The Advanced Certificate in Soft Computing in Hydrologic Systems is designed for professionals, researchers, and graduate students with a background in hydrology, environmental science, or related fields. Aimed at enhancing expertise in the application of soft computing techniques, the programme integrates advanced concepts in fuzzy logic, neural networks, and genetic algorithms to model and predict hydrologic systems. It also covers practical applications of these techniques in water resource management, flood prediction, and climate change impact assessment.

Learners will develop a robust set of skills including the ability to design and implement soft computing models for hydrological data analysis, perform complex hydrological modeling, and interpret the results for informed decision-making. The programme emphasizes the integration of these techniques with traditional hydrological methods to provide a comprehensive approach to solving hydrological challenges. Key knowledge areas include the theoretical foundations of soft computing, the selection and application of appropriate algorithms for specific hydrological problems, and the use of advanced software tools for data processing and visualization.

What This Course Covers

  1. Fuzzy Logic: Introduces the theory and application of fuzzy sets and fuzzy logic.: Neural Networks: Covers the basics of artificial neural networks and their use in hydrologic systems.
  2. Genetic Algorithms: Explores the principles and applications of genetic algorithms in optimization problems.: Neuro-Fuzzy Systems: Combines neural networks and fuzzy logic to develop adaptive models.
  3. Evolutionary Algorithms: Discusses various evolutionary algorithms and their application in hydrology.: Case Studies: Analyzes real-world hydrologic systems using soft computing techniques.
